This sumptuous period villa dating back to the early 1900s enjoys a privileged position overlooking one of the most picturesque views of Lake Maggiore. Surrounded by a vast 5,500 sqm terraced parkland, the property harmoniously integrates into the surrounding natural landscape. The elegant garden offers pleasant and shaded pathways winding through a variety of plants and majestic trees, enriched by beautiful stone fountains, a linear and elegant facade characterized by a splendid terrace at the center that seems to extend directly over the lake. At the upper part of the garden, there is a magnificent infinity pool with a large sunbathing area equipped with the comfort of a well-appointed area below it, including changing rooms, comfortable bathrooms, and showers available. The luxurious property extends over 1,000 sqm, including the main villa, the caretaker’s lodge, and a guest house. The first two buildings, together with the garden and the modern panoramic pool, offer state-of-the-art comfort and technology. The main residence, with its classic and elegant style, spans three levels and features six bedrooms and seven bathrooms. The ground floor welcomes a spacious entrance hall, a large living area, a dining room, a lounge with fireplace, a guest bathroom, and a fully equipped kitchen. The upper floor hosts two comfortable master bedrooms with a terrace, en-suite bathroom, walk-in closet, and private study, while on the second floor there are four more bedrooms and corresponding bathrooms.
